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/google-cloud-platform/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
DotNetNuke模态弹出对话框的样式错误_Dotnetnuke - Fatal编程技术网

DotNetNuke模态弹出对话框的样式错误

DotNetNuke模态弹出对话框的样式错误,dotnetnuke,Dotnetnuke,我有一个旧的DNN站点,它已经升级了好几次,从5.6.2到6.2.5、6.2.8、7.0.5,现在是7.0.6。大多数情况下,一切正常,但弹出模式对话框(如设置对话框)看起来很奇怪。具体来说,我的浏览器窗口的大小非常窄。如果我只需单击右下角的resize控件,它就会弹出正常大小。此外,右上角的“关闭”和“最大化”控件将被裁剪,即“溢出”设置为“隐藏”。我可以从Chrome开发者工具中看到,在element.style规则中,至少“overflow”css样式被设置为隐藏。我不知道这是从哪里来的。

我有一个旧的DNN站点,它已经升级了好几次,从5.6.2到6.2.5、6.2.8、7.0.5,现在是7.0.6。大多数情况下,一切正常,但弹出模式对话框(如设置对话框)看起来很奇怪。具体来说,我的浏览器窗口的大小非常窄。如果我只需单击右下角的resize控件,它就会弹出正常大小。此外,右上角的“关闭”和“最大化”控件将被裁剪,即“溢出”设置为“隐藏”。我可以从Chrome开发者工具中看到,在element.style规则中,至少“overflow”css样式被设置为隐藏。我不知道这是从哪里来的。我怀疑这是由于皮肤是一种老化的、无反应的皮肤,对此我不太了解。有人能给我指出正确的方向,如何使这些看起来正确吗?当我在网站上工作时,这有点烦人

谢谢

编辑:添加了屏幕截图。我在右上角圈出了裁剪过的控件,您可以看到对话框的宽度仅为其应有宽度的1/3左右。谢谢你花时间在这个问题上帮助我。

为什么升级DNN而不升级皮肤。这就像是在选美会上给模特穿上破烂衣服,期待他们获胜。如果你不想花钱买新的皮肤,那么用DNN(ie. DarkKnight,重力)的默认皮肤作为你的基础,然后定制你的需要。谢谢。你的观点是正确的。我们有一个自定义皮肤,我正在升级它。实际上,我把主页切换到黑暗骑士主页皮肤只是为了测试它,这并没有解决问题,所以我仍然在寻找…如果你发布一个屏幕截图,让我们都能看到你看到的我想我会发布我的解决方案和一些观察结果,这可能会有所帮助。由于我的网站没有太多的数据库纠葛,也就是说,它纯粹是一个信息网站,我只是去了一个新安装的DNN7上重新编辑了该网站,它工作得很好。直到我想使用jQuery选项卡。一旦我添加了对“./jqueryui.css”的引用,这些弹出框上的样式就开始出现错误。我还没有深入研究它,但它看起来确实像jQueryUI中的冲突。